Mineral processing art of treating crude ores and mineral products in order to separate the valuable minerals from the waste rock or gangue It is the first process that most ores undergo after mining in order to provide a more concentrated material for the procedures of extractive metallurgy

— The first comminution stage in a mineral processing plant is crushing which reduces the size of particles from up to 1 m down to cm depending on the type of milling circuit Crushing is typically a dry process that makes use of Gyratory Jaw and Cone crushers Napier Munn et al 1996 which predominantly make use of impact mechanism
